The event on June 7, 2025, will be held at the Prudential Center in Newark, New Jersey. This event is the sixth pay-per-view event of the year. It features an exciting lineup with five main fights, including two championship matches. In a highly anticipated rematch, Merab Dvalishvili will defend his bantamweight title against former champion Sean O’Malley. Dvalishvili clinched the belt at UFC 306, decisively defeating O’Malley unanimously. Since that win, he has defended his title against Umar Nurmagomedov. Meanwhile, O’Malley has focused on returning his championship after recovering from surgery. This UFC 316 fight will be exciting, as O’Malley brings knockout power, and Dvalishvili relies on strong grappling skills. It’s a clear matchup of a striker against a wrestler. Background and MMA career
Nicknamed “The Machine” for good reason, Merab Dvalishvili possesses one of the highest cardio levels in the UFC. Dvalishvili is a Georgian and American professional mixed martial artist. He remains relentlessly active, never allowing his opponents a moment to breathe. Merab Dvalishvili began his MMA career in 2014. He fought for CFFC and Ring of Combat, achieving a record of 7 wins and two losses before joining the UFC. His exceptional endurance in high-volume wrestling and striking exchanges during championship rounds set him apart from his competitors. Dvalishvili relentlessly pushes forward, draining his opponent’s gas tank and wearing them down mentally, even after multiple takedowns. Dvalishvili’s endurance helps him excel in longer fights. He often outworks his opponents with his intense aggression. Merab Dvalishvili is a leading fighter in the UFC bantamweight division. He is mainly known for his grappling skills but also has strong defensive abilities in striking situations. His head movement helps him evade powerful shots, and his resilience allows him to absorb punishment without losing momentum. Dvalishvili UFC excels in counter striking and footwork, which enables him to set up takedowns while minimizing damage. As he prepares to defend his title against Sean O’Malley, the key question is whether he can neutralize O’Malley’s striking. Sean Daniel O’Malley, widely known as “Suga,” is among the most electrifying rising stars in the UFC Bantamweight division. He was born on October 24, 1994, in Helena, Montana. Sean O’Malley has quickly gained attention for his unique style and charming personality. He is an American professional mixed martial artist. He started his MMA career in 2013. Malley has a strong background in Taekwondo, which helps his fast movements and creative strikes. He trains at The MMA Lab in Phoenix, Arizona, with coach John Crouch and his longtime coach Tim Welch. Malley made a strong entrance into the UFC by showcasing his skills on Dana White’s Contender Series. He scored an impressive first-round knockout against Alfred Khashakyan, which earned him a contract with the UFC. Since then, he has become one of the most exciting fighters in the sport. He shows a unique mix of impressive moves, knockout strength, and strong confidence that fans connect with. Malley, a creative UFC striker with Taekwondo roots, uses spinning kicks and clever angles to keep opponents guessing. His skillful transitions between boxing and kickboxing led to impressive knockouts. Malley UFC is known for his striking but also has a brown belt in Brazilian Jiu-Jitsu. His long limbs help him grapple, though he prefers to keep fights standing. Sean O’Malley is a fan favorite in MMA, known for his charisma, entertaining style, and strong social media presence. His self-marketing has made him a recognizable figure in the UFC and a rising icon in the MMA.

Prediction for UFC 316
Merab Dvalishvili vs. Sean O’Malley
The main event of UFC 316 features two exciting fighters in the bantamweight division. Each fighter brings their unique strengths to the octagon. Dvalishvili started with a loss against Darren Mima in his MMA career. After a loss, he performed inconsistently from 2014 to 2018. Then, Dvalishvili UFC had 14 consecutive victories from 2018 to 2025. Merab Dvalishvili has improved his striking but lacks the technical finesse of top strikers like Sean O’Malley and Cory Sandhagen. His striking mainly serves to set up takedowns rather than dominate in stand-up exchanges. He has substantial volume and pressure but struggles against top strikers who keep their distance and stop takedowns. Dvalishvili’s fighting style focuses on wearing down opponents over multiple rounds instead of aiming for quick knockouts. This approach can lead to exhausting battles that require great cardio. If he faces opponents who can knock him out, relying on striking a lot might not work well. He will have difficulty doing real damage if they stop his takedowns and keep the fight standing. In his first fight with Sean O’Malley, Dvalishvili took him down several times but struggled to maintain control. As of September 17, 2024, Sean O’Malley is the top bantamweight fighter in the UFC. He is also ranked 14th in the men’s pound-for-pound standings as of May 13, 2025. Despite an impressive record, O’Malley has faced criticism regarding his level of competition, with some arguing he hasn’t fought enough elite-level opponents. Nonetheless, he has notable victories over Petr Yan and Marlon Vera. O’Malley faced challenges against Merab Dvalishvili, revealing struggles with pressure and wrestling. While his striking is strong, he has vulnerabilities in his ground game and takedown defense against elite grapplers. O’Malley struggled with takedowns against Dvalishvili and may face challenges against elite grapplers. Still, he’s an exciting fighter known for his creative striking and knockout power. Is he ready for his rematch with Merab Dvalishvili at UFC 316, and has he improved his takedown defense? If he can maintain distance and unleash his signature strikes, he is well-positioned to reclaim the bantamweight title. Julianna Pena vs. Kayla Harrison
Julianna Nicole Pena boasts an impressive 2-0 record as an amateur and is a formidable American professional mixed martial artist. Since her MMA debut in May 2009, she won four consecutive fights by 2011. Despite losing to DeAnna Bennett and Sarah Moras, Pena strengthened in recent fights. Julianna Pena used to be the champion in her weight class in the UFC. She is strong and never gives up, even when things get tough. She is very good at making her opponents give up, which makes her dangerous in a fight. Pena UFC won a major match against Raquel Pennington on October 5, 2024. She is a fierce competitor with a relentless fighting style. As the first woman to win The Ultimate Fighter, Pena has consistently demonstrated her grit and determination inside the octagon. Her wrestling arsenal is a key strength, enabling her to control opponents and pace her fights. Paired with her durability and aggressive approach, she presents a formidable challenge for anyone in the bantamweight division. Julianna Pena will defend her title against Kayla Harrison in an exciting matchup. This UFC 316 could challenge Pena’s ability to control the fight. Kayla Jean Harrison is a strong athlete in MMA. She is making a name for herself as she moves from her successful judo career to becoming a formidable competitor in the UFC. Harrison has cemented her legacy as the first and only American to clinch an Olympic gold medal in judo. A two-time Olympic gold medalist and dominant in MMA, her unmatched grappling allows her to control opponents on the ground. With her striking skills continuously improving, she rapidly becomes a well-rounded fighter. While Harrison UFC hasn’t faced top bantamweights yet, her journey is intriguing—questions about her cardio loom, especially as she prepares to fight Julianna Pena at UFC 316. Pena’s relentless pressure and championship experience could be a significant challenge. In her UFC debut, Harrison exudes invincibility, supported by an unmatched grappling pedigree.
